岩石学报 1999
Precambrian granitic rocks,continental crustal evolution and craton formation of the North China Platform.
|
Abstract:
Based on study of Precambrian granitic rocks, this paper suggests that T 1T 2, T 1T 2G 1G 2 and G 1G 2 associations represent inmature,semi mature and mature continental crustal composition, respectively. Continental root and its nature are discussed. Ten Archean continental nucleuses have been recognized. Formation of Mezoarchean initial continental nucleus, Archean continental nucleus in Neoarchean, two micro continental scale continental nucleus in the latest Archean, and formation of the North China craton by tectonic assemblage of the two mature continental nucleuses in Paleoproterozoic are disussed.
